First of all, you need to prepare the oven and preheat it. Set the oven perfectly and open the gas valve.

Before making the ooni pizza recipe, preheat the oven for about 20 minutes so that the stone gets heat perfectly. We recommend the Ooni Koda 12 from Botanex for this recipe

If you’re experiencing windy weather, you need to set the angle of the oven accurately to prevent gusts. If the pizza stone is heated enough, you can start cooking.

Make sure you use sensational flour named “00” flour. It will make the pizza dough smooth and allow you to stretch it naturally.

Also, this flour has superb texture and a mind-blowing flavor.  Here you can choose a full-size rigid Ooni pizza peel to get fantastic pizza.

True to say, this flour is best to make perfect pizza in an Ooni koda pizza oven. You can now get the Ooni pizza oven in an online marketplace.

Now, ready the pizza sauce, cheese, and toppings to make the pizza more alluring. Make sure you make these ingredients before stretching the pizza dough.

Because if you make the sauce after stretching pizza dough, your dough will be sticky that ruins your pizza-making experience.

It is better to work with two pieces of a pizza peel. Remember to stretch the pizza peel and ingredients to room temperatures after making the dough.

Here you can use “prep peel” and “warm peel” to make the ingredients turning and retrieving properly.

Don’t use metal peel that will make the dough sticky. After that, you should roughly flour everything using your hands. Here you need to spray some water gently.

After making the dough and all ingredients ready, you need to check if there is any hole inside the dough.

If you’re not experiencing any holes or tears, you are ready to keep your pizza in the oven. After 10 to 15  seconds, you need to slide your peel beneath the pizza.

Do this repeatedly until the pizza is cooked properly. After completing the cooking process you can go to the next step.

The next step is to add pizza sauce, cheese, and toppings. You need to take off the peel and give it some heat.

If you see the dough is soft and sticky, add some flour to tighten the dough. Be cautious when you’re spreading the sauce over the pizza.
